  4. Technerd.McLeod's Avatar
    Question, English isn't your first language?

    I don't know what the 102 code error is, but from the sounds of it, you need to reload the OS onto the phone.

    Uninstall any OS on the computer, install desired OS on the computer, plug in phone and open DM or AppLoader(C:/Program Files/Common Files/Research In Motion/Loader?) <- Something like that. DM works just as good. Follow instructions for AppLoader, on DM you have to hit Update and follow instructions.

    There are better guides on CrackBerry to reinstalling an OS.

  7. pmccartney's Avatar
    You wont be able to use Desktop Manager. You will use Loader.exe as described in Step#1 of the link.
    BlackBerry 101: How to Reload the Operating System on a Nuked BlackBerry | CrackBerry.com
    Close attention to Step#2. This is where many get it wrong.
